My name is POOKIE. My Animal ID # is A1047989. – P
I am a female torbie and calico domestic sh mix. The shelter thinks I am about 1 YEAR 6 MONTHS old.

I came in the shelter as a OWNER SUR on 08/15/2015 from NY 10011, owner surrender reason stated was ALLERGIES.

MOST RECENT MEDICAL INFORMATION AND WEIGHT
08/15/2015 Exam Type VACCINATE – Medical Rating is 1 – NORMAL , Behavior Rating is NONE, Weight 6.5 LBS.

GAVE 0.6 CC PYRANTEL

08/15/2015 PET PROFILE MEMO
08/15/15 17:00hrs Pookie is female domestic shorthair cat that has lived with her owner for the past year and a half since she was found as a kitten. She is being surrendered because her owner now lives with a family member that is allergic to her. SOCIAL LIFE & PERSONALITY Pookie is described as an aloof cat that seeks out affection when she wants it. Pookie has lived with 1 year old and 4 year old children and was respectful of them. Her owner stated that she would rub up against them when she wanted attention but would run off before the children could play with her. She also lived with a shih-Tzu dog and rarely interacted with the dog because the dog would bark at her and she would run off. BEHAVIOR Pookie is litter box trained and is accustomed to using crystal litter in an uncovered litter box. She grooms herself and doesn’t like to be brushed. Her owner stated that she can normally be found sleeping somewhere in the home. FOR A NEW FAMILY TO KNOW Pookie is an independent cat that allows minimal petting. She doesn’t play with cat toys much nor scratches her owner’s furniture. She is fed dry cat food 2x a day. She likes sleeping in bed with her owner. DURING INTAKE Pookie was crouched in the rear of her carrier. When she was approached she would back away, but she was able to be handled without incident. She was collared, scanned for a microchip (negative) and photographed without incident.

08/18/2015 BEHAVIOR EVALUATION – EXPNOCHILD
Exam Type BEHAVIOR
Pookie is described as an aloof cat that seeks out affection when she wants it. Pookie has lived with 1 year old and 4 year old children and was respectful of them. Her owner stated that she would rub up against them when she wanted attention but would run off before the children could play with her. She also lived with a shih-Tzu dog and rarely interacted with the dog because the dog would bark at her and she would run off. Reaction to assessor: Pookie looks neutral in her cage when approached by the assessor. Reaction to door opening: Pookie remains resting on her cage bedding, alert with eyes wide open. Reaction to touch: Pookie hesitates in place then hisses at first, but accepts the touch and flinches with ears down to her side with pupils fully dilated. Placement determination: Experience / no child Pookie tolerates attention and petting but may be fearful in the shelter, and may be intimidated by small children. Due to the behaviors seen in the care center, we feel that this cat will do best in a calm, quiet home with experienced cat parents and without children.
